Why Does Water Come Into My Home Through the Electrical Panel?
Seeing water near or in your electrical panel is a major red flag. It’s not just a minor inconvenience; it’s a potentially dangerous situation. Understanding why this happens is the first step to addressing it. Several common culprits can lead to water finding its way into this critical part of your home’s electrical system.
Common Causes of Water Intrusion
Water doesn’t just magically appear. There’s usually a reason, and often it’s related to your home’s structure or its plumbing. We’ve seen many cases where simple issues escalate into bigger problems if not addressed promptly.
Plumbing Leaks Above the Panel
A leaky pipe or fixture located directly above your electrical panel is a frequent cause. Even a slow drip can eventually find its way down. This moisture can then seep into the panel box, creating a hazardous environment. It’s a classic case of gravity doing its work, unfortunately.
Foundation Cracks and Basement Water
If your electrical panel is in the basement, cracks in the foundation can allow groundwater to seep in. Heavy rains or snowmelt can exacerbate this. This water can then travel along walls and wiring, eventually reaching the panel. The constant presence of moisture is a primary concern here.
Sewer Backups and Sewage Hazards
In severe cases, especially during major floods, sewage lines can back up. If your panel is located in an area affected by a sewage backup, the contaminated water can enter the panel. Dealing with sewage hazards after indoor flooding is a serious concern, as this water is unsanitary and dangerous.
Roof Leaks and Attic Water
While less common for basement or ground-level panels, if wiring runs through an attic space with a roof leak, water can travel down. This is particularly true if the panel is on an upper floor or the wiring is routed in a way that allows water to follow. You might also notice hidden moisture after water damage in unexpected places.
HVAC System Issues
Condensation from your HVAC system can sometimes leak. If a drain line clogs or a pan overflows, water can drip. If this happens near your electrical panel, it can lead to water intrusion. This is a less obvious source but still a possibility.
The Dangers of a Wet Electrical Panel
Let’s be clear: water and electricity are a terrible combination. A wet electrical panel is not something to take lightly. The risks are immediate and severe. Understanding these dangers can help you appreciate the urgency of the situation.
Electrical Hazards After Water Damage
The primary danger is electrocution. Water conducts electricity, and a wet panel means live electrical components are surrounded by a conductive medium. This dramatically increases the risk of electric shock. It can also lead to short circuits, potentially causing fires. Always be aware of electrical hazards after water damage.
Corrosion and Long-Term Damage
Even if immediate shocks are avoided, water can cause corrosion within the panel. This can lead to intermittent electrical problems, flickering lights, and eventually, failure of components. This damage to electrical wiring can be expensive to repair.
Fire Risks
When water mixes with electrical current, it can create arcs and sparks. These can easily ignite nearby flammable materials, leading to a house fire. This is why safety checks for damaged wiring are so important after any water event.
Contamination Risks
If the water is from a source like a flood or sewer backup, it carries contaminants. These contamination risks in floodwater can be serious. The water can be full of bacteria, chemicals, and other harmful substances, posing health risks even before the electrical danger is considered.
What to Do When You See Water Near Your Panel
The most important thing is to stay calm and act quickly. Your safety and the safety of your family are the top priorities. Here’s what research and expert advice suggest you should do.
Immediate Safety Steps
Do not touch the electrical panel or any wet switches or outlets if you suspect water intrusion. If you can do so safely, turn off the main power to your home at the breaker box if it is dry and accessible. If there’s any doubt, leave it alone.
Identify the Water Source
Try to determine where the water is coming from. Is it a visible leak? Is the area generally damp? Knowing the source is key to preventing future problems. You might also notice water damage warning signs elsewhere in your home.

What if the water came from a lightning strike?
Lightning strikes can cause significant damage to a home’s electrical system, sometimes indirectly leading to water intrusion. While lightning itself doesn’t directly push water into panels, the surge it causes can damage wiring, insulation, or even structural components, creating pathways for water. If you suspect lightning damage, it’s crucial to have both the electrical system and any potential water entry points inspected. Can my light fixtures leak water when it rains?
Yes, it’s possible. Water dripping from light fixtures, especially during rain, often indicates a leak in the roof, attic, or the wall cavity above. This water can travel down wiring or through structural gaps to reach the fixture. It’s a clear sign that you need to investigate potential water damage warning signs in your attic or roof. What are the risks of a wet outlet?
A wet electrical outlet poses similar risks to a wet panel: electrocution, short circuits, and fire. Water can seep into the outlet box, making any connected appliance or device dangerous to use. How does smoke affect electrical wiring?
While smoke itself is not conductive like water, it can leave behind corrosive residues that damage electrical wiring over time. More importantly, fires that produce smoke often involve heat that can directly damage wiring insulation, leading to short circuits or other electrical failures. Is floodwater in my panel dangerous even if the power is off?
Yes, floodwater in your panel is dangerous even if the main power is off. The water can contain contaminants, and residual electrical charge might still be present in some components. Furthermore, the water can cause corrosion and long-term damage. It is absolutely critical to address contamination risks in floodwater and ensure the panel is properly serviced.
